In the summer, set the thermostat to a higher temperature like 80\u00b0F. This will minimize energy usage and prevent the system from overworking to cool an empty home. Conversely, lower the thermostat in the winter months. Setting it to 55-60\u00b0F will prevent pipes from freezing while saving electricity that would otherwise be used to heat an vacant house. Programmable thermostats make this step easy by allowing you to set customized temperatures for the timeframe that you&#8217;ll be away. Walk around the entire interior and exterior of your home to ensure doors and windows are shut tight and locked. Pay special attention to the following areas:<\/span><\/p>\n<p><b>Front and back doors<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> &#8211; Check that the deadbolts and door knobs are locked.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><b>Garage doors<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> &#8211; Make sure the garage door is all the way down and that any side entry doors are locked. Disconnect the automatic garage door opener so the door cannot be opened remotely.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><b>Sliding glass doors and windows<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> &#8211; Slide the doors and windows shut tightly and lock any integrated locks or use dowels\/pins to prevent them from being opened or lifted from the outside. Close and lock any window latches.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><b>Basement doors and windows<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> &#8211; Make sure all basement entry points are locked or blocked. Secure basement windows with locks or dowel rods if accessible from the outside.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><b>Pet doors<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> &#8211; Lock pet doors or block access to them so they cannot be used to gain entry.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><b>Gates, sheds, or other outbuildings<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> &#8211; Check that all gates, sheds, and structures on the property are locked up tight.\u00a0<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Taking time to double check all locks provides peace of mind that your home is properly secured. Be sure to keep spare keys with a trusted neighbor rather than hiding them outside, which could aid burglars. Thoroughly locking all entry points deters opportunistic break-ins while you are away.<\/span><\/p>\n<p>&nbsp;<\/p>\n<h2><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Install Security Cameras<\/span><\/h2>\n<p>&nbsp;<\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Setting up <\/span><a href=\"https:\/\/jnadealerprogram.com\/blog\/vivint-package\/\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">security cameras<\/span><\/a><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> is one of the most effective ways to deter burglars and monitor your home while you&#8217;re away. The goal is to automate lights to turn on and off at appropriate times throughout the day and night, just as they normally would if you were home.\u00a0<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">There are several options for lighting timers, including mechanical timers, digital timers, and smart lighting systems. Mechanical timers are simple dial timers that you plug lights into to turn them on and off at preset times. Digital timers can be programmed more precisely, allowing you to set multiple on\/off times for different intervals. Smart lighting systems take it a step further, allowing you to control lighting remotely via smartphone.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">When setting up lighting timers, aim to mimic your normal usage patterns. Set interior lights in living spaces, bedrooms, and bathrooms to turn on in the morning and evening hours. Exterior lighting by doors and in the backyard should be programmed to turn on at dusk and off later at night.\u00a0<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Stagger the lighting schedules and vary the length of time lights are left on to make it less obvious they are on timers. Setting different schedules for different parts of the house creates a lived-in look. Turning on some lights for just an hour or two in the evening suggests someone is home active in that part of the house.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Using lighting timers is an easy way to make your home look occupied with minimal effort while you&#8217;re away.
